Window FAQs

How energy efficient are uPVC windows?

UPVC windows are highly energy efficient due to their excellent thermal insulation properties. They reduce heat loss and provide a superior barrier against heat transfer compared to traditional materials, helping to maintain a consistent indoor temperature while also reducing energy bills. UPVC windows are often rated A+ or A++ for energy efficiency, especially with double or triple glazing. By minimising air leakage and maximising heat retention, uPVC windows contribute significantly to reducing energy consumption.

How do I maintain and clean uPVC windows?

To keep your uPVC windows looking their best, start by wiping away any debris with a soft cloth. Then use warm soapy water to wash the frames with a non-abrasive sponge or cloth. Rinse thoroughly and buff dry. If you really want your windows to shine, cleaning with a vinegar-water solution (2 cups of water with ¼ cup of vinegar) works wonders. Always avoid harsh chemicals like bleach. Cleaning every couple of months will help keep your windows looking their best.

How do uPVC windows compare to other window materials, such as wood or aluminium?

UPVC windows offer several advantages over wood and aluminium windows. Unlike wood, uPVC doesn’t rot, warp, or require frequent painting, making it virtually maintenance-free and more durable in the long run. UPVC also provides better thermal insulation than aluminium, as aluminium conducts heat and cold more easily. While aluminium frames can be stronger and slimmer, allowing for larger panes of glass, uPVC windows generally offer a better balance of energy efficiency, cost-effectiveness, and ease of maintenance.
